Ingredients

20 min
Serves 3 servings
  1. 1 bagtortilla chips
  2. 9 ozground beef (about 250 grams)
  3. 1 cupshredded cheddar cheese (about 3.5 oz or 100 grams)
  4. 1 cupshredded mozzarella cheese (about 3.5 oz or 100 grams)
  5. 2 tablespoonssliced jalapeños (about 0.7 oz or 20 grams)
  6. Salt
  7. Black pepper
  8. Oregano
  9. Hot paprika
  10. 1small jar Mexican salsa

Cooking Instructions

20 min
  1. 1

    In a large skillet, heat a little olive oil and add the ground beef. Cook over low heat. Season with salt, a pinch of oregano, black pepper, and hot paprika.

  2. 2

    When the beef is cooked, add the jar of Mexican salsa to the skillet. Mix well and set aside.

  3. 3

    In a glass baking dish, make a layer of tortilla chips, then add some ground beef, cheddar cheese, and mozzarella. Add another layer of chips and repeat until all ingredients are used.

  4. 4

    Bake at 350-375°F (180-190°C) for 12-15 minutes.

  5. 5

    Finally, sprinkle chopped jalapeños on top for an extra spicy kick.
